Fig. 1. Sequence alignment of human and mouse GPVI. / (A) The predicted signal peptides and transmembrane domains are underlined. Potential N-linked glycosylation sites are indicted in bold. The amino acid sequences of human and mouse GPVI share 64.4% identity. (B) The nucleotide sequences of human and mouse GPVI cDNA share 67.3% identity.
